Why Knowing Emergency Numbers in Laos is Important

Emergencies can arise unexpectedly, whether related to health, crime, fire, or accidents. In such moments, quick access to the correct emergency contact can save lives and prevent further complications. For travelers, expatriates, and locals alike, memorizing or keeping a list of emergency numbers is a vital part of staying safe in Laos.

Main Emergency Numbers in Laos

Unlike some countries that use a single emergency hotline for all services, Laos has different numbers for police, medical, and fire emergencies. Here are the primary emergency numbers you should know:

Police

191 is the direct emergency number for police assistance in Laos. Call this number if you witness or are involved in a crime, need urgent law enforcement support, or feel unsafe.

Ambulance and Medical Emergency

195 connects you to ambulance and emergency medical services. This number should be used in case of serious illness, injuries, or any health crisis requiring immediate attention.

Fire Department

190 is the number to contact the fire department in Laos. Use this in the event of fire outbreaks or related emergencies.
